Shadow of hidden dock type windows is still visible

Bug #458385 reported by Graham Whelan
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
compiz (Ubuntu)
Triaged
Low
Unassigned

Bug Description

Binary package hint: compiz

The shadows for windows with the flag WINDOW_TYPE_HINT_DOCK set are still visible even after the window has been hidden. Also the shadows for dock windows appear to be drawn below all other windows directly onto the desktop.

This may be related to the patch:

compiz (1:0.8.2-0ubuntu16) karmic; urgency=low

  [ Travis Watkins ]
  * debian/patches/015_draw_dock_shadows_on_desktop.patch:
    - change decoration plugin to draw dock shadows only on the desktop window instead of on top of all other windows

mentioned in Bug #91786.

I've attached some simple PyGTK code to demonstrate the problem.

Thanks

ProblemType: Bug
Architecture: amd64
CompizPlugins: [core,move,resize,place,decoration,animation,ccp,dbus,mousepoll,gnomecompat,png,svg,imgjpeg,text,commands,neg,video,wall,snap,scale,scaleaddon,expo,staticswitcher,regex,resizeinfo,workarounds,ezoom,vpswitch,extrawm,fade,session,shift,wobbly]
Date: Thu Oct 22 18:32:54 2009
DistroRelease: Ubuntu 9.10
MachineType: Zepto Znote
NonfreeKernelModules: nvidia
Package: compiz 1:0.8.4-0ubuntu2
PackageArchitecture: all
PccardctlIdent:
 Socket 0:
   no product info available
PccardctlStatus:
 Socket 0:
   no card
PciDisplay: 01:00.0 VGA compatible controller [0300]: nVidia Corporation G84 [GeForce 8600M GT] [10de:0407] (rev a1)
ProcCmdLine: BOOT_IMAGE=/boot/vmlinuz-2.6.31-11-generic root=UUID=935fee6e-ba75-4357-adf6-418d2a3bc689 ro quiet splash
ProcEnviron:
 PATH=(custom, user)
 LANG=en_IE.UTF-8
 SHELL=/bin/bash
ProcVersionSignature: Ubuntu 2.6.31-11.36-generic
RelatedPackageVersions:
 xserver-xorg 1:7.4+3ubuntu7
 libgl1-mesa-glx 7.6.0-1ubuntu4
 libdrm2 2.4.14-1ubuntu1
 xserver-xorg-video-intel 2:2.9.0-1ubuntu2
 xserver-xorg-video-ati 1:6.12.99+git20090929.7968e1fb-0ubuntu1
SourcePackage: compiz
Uname: Linux 2.6.31-11-generic x86_64
dmi.bios.date: 07/27/2007
dmi.bios.vendor: Phoenix Technologies LTD
dmi.bios.version: Z15N008
dmi.board.name: Znote
dmi.board.vendor: Zepto
dmi.board.version: 6025WD/6625WD
dmi.chassis.asset.tag: No Asset Tag
dmi.chassis.type: 1
dmi.chassis.vendor: Zepto
dmi.chassis.version: N/A
dmi.modalias: dmi:bvnPhoenixTechnologiesLTD:bvrZ15N008:bd07/27/2007:svnZepto:pnZnote:pvr6625WD:rvnZepto:rnZnote:rvr6025WD/6625WD:cvnZepto:ct1:cvrN/A:
dmi.product.name: Znote
dmi.product.version: 6625WD
dmi.sys.vendor: Zepto
system: distro = Ubuntu, architecture = x86_64, kernel = 2.6.31-11-generic

Revision history for this message
Graham Whelan (gawhelan) wrote :
Revision history for this message
Travis Watkins (amaranth) wrote :

What actual application are you seeing with this problem other than the invest-applet? gnome-panel is the only thing that should be getting a shadow from compiz and setting itself as a dock type window and it works fine with autohide.

Changed in compiz (Ubuntu):
importance: Undecided → Low
status: New → Triaged
Revision history for this message
Graham Whelan (gawhelan) wrote :

I'm only seeing the problem with my own applications. For example, I'm writing a launcher app like gnome-do and I'm using the dock type hint for the main window. I don't expect this to be a priority for anyone as it probably doesn't affect any users at the moment but I just wanted to make sure that the errant behaviour is noted and that the bug is reported.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.